The Middle East Institute is pleased to host author Rachel Bronson on her new book, Thicker than Oil: The United States and Saudi Arabia, A History. Bronson’s book reveals why the US-Saudi partnership became so intimate and how the countries' shared interests sowed the seeds of today's most pressing problem--Islamic radicalism.

Dr. Bronson is a senior fellow and Director of Middle East Studies at the Council on Foreign Relations. She has testified before Congress’ Joint Economic Committee on the topic of Iraq’s reconstruction, and the President’s 9-11 Commission.

Dr. Bronson is the recipient of the Carnegie Corporation’s 2003 Carnegie Scholars award. She has served as a consultant to the Center for Naval Analyses, as a Senior Fellow at the Center for Strategic and International Studies in Washington, D.C., and as a Fellow at Harvard's Center for Science and International Affairs.
